Have you ever want to create your own AI repaints but don't know how to use Photoshop or any other photo editing software?

Don't despair, I have now created a tool called One Click Repaint.
The idea is that anyone can create generic GA paints either in 1024x1024 dds (dxt5 with mipmaps) or bmp (32bit without mipmaps) formats.

Right now the only aircraft available is Cessna 172 with 14 livery options, however I am working on adding more aircraft and liveries.

Simple instructions:
Select aircraft and livery.
Make changes to colours and set various options.
Add registration details.
Click "Update" to preview the results. The preview is sized at 512x512, however when downloading the file the texture will be in 1024x1024.
If you are happy with the results, select format (FS9 for bmp and FSX for dds), tick "Save on update" and click "Update".
A download link will appear and this will let you download the file. You can also share your repaint with others by sending them a "share link" via Facebook, Twitter, email, forums or whichever way you choose.

You can continue working on and adjusting a previously created texture via the "share link".
